Factors Affecting Clothing Weight
Several key factors influence the weight of any given garment. Understanding these factors is essential for accurate weight estimation:
1. Fabric Type: The Foundation of Weight
The fabric type is arguably the most significant factor determining clothing weight. Different fibers have vastly different densities. For example:
-
Lightweight Fabrics: Silk, linen, rayon, and certain types of cotton are known for their lightweight properties. Garments made from these fabrics will generally weigh less.
-
Mid-weight Fabrics: Denim, twill, and some blends of cotton and polyester fall into this category. Their weight is moderate, making them suitable for a wide range of clothing items.
-
Heavyweight Fabrics: Wool, cashmere, heavy cotton canvas, and leather are examples of heavyweight fabrics. Garments made from these materials are significantly heavier.
2. Fabric Construction: Weave and Knit
The way the fabric is constructed—woven or knitted—also plays a role in its weight. Woven fabrics, like denim, tend to be denser and heavier than knitted fabrics, like jersey. The type of weave itself (plain weave, twill, satin, etc.) also affects the fabric's density and therefore its weight.
3. Garment Construction: Seams and Layers
The number of layers, the type of seams (double-stitched seams add weight), and the inclusion of interfacing or other reinforcing materials all contribute to the overall weight of a garment. A heavily lined winter coat will naturally weigh more than a simple t-shirt, even if they are made from similar fabrics.
4. Garment Size and Dimensions: Bigger is Heavier
Larger garments naturally weigh more than smaller ones, simply due to the greater surface area and volume of fabric used. A size XL shirt will inevitably be heavier than a size S shirt of the same fabric.
5. Finishing Treatments: Added Weight
Various finishing treatments applied during manufacturing can also affect the weight. Treatments like water-repellent coatings, stiffening agents, and certain dyes can add to the overall weight of a garment.
Methods for Estimating Clothing Weight
Precisely determining the weight of a garment requires using a scale. However, estimations can be made using various methods:
1. Using a Scale: The Most Accurate Method
The most accurate way to determine the weight of clothing is by using a kitchen or postal scale. Simply weigh the garment and record the weight in grams or ounces.
2. Comparing to Known Weights: A Relative Approach
If you don't have a scale, you can estimate weight by comparing the garment to items whose weight you know. For instance, a heavy wool sweater might feel roughly equivalent to a bag of sugar (approximately 2 pounds or 900 grams). This method is less precise but offers a reasonable approximation.
3. Using Fabric Weight Charts: A Manufacturer's Perspective
Some fabric manufacturers provide weight charts specifying the weight per square yard or meter of their fabrics. This information can be used to estimate the weight of a garment, especially if you know its dimensions. This method requires careful measurement of the garment.
4. Online Resources and Databases: Collective Knowledge
While less common, certain online databases or garment-specific websites may provide weight information for particular clothing items. However, the accuracy and reliability of this information should be carefully considered.
Weight of Different Clothing Types: A Comparative Analysis
The following table provides a general overview of the weight ranges for various common clothing types. Remember that these are estimates and actual weight can vary significantly depending on the factors discussed above:
| Clothing Type | Weight Range (grams) | Weight Range (ounces) | Notes |
|---|---|---|---|
| T-shirt (cotton) | 100-250 | 3.5-8.8 | Varies greatly depending on fabric weight |
| Jeans (denim) | 500-800 | 17.6-28.2 | Weight increases with heavier denim |
| Sweater (wool) | 300-700 | 10.6-24.7 | Heavier with thicker wool |
| Jacket (lightweight) | 200-500 | 7.1-17.6 | Varies significantly by material |
| Coat (heavyweight) | 1000-2000 | 35.3-70.5 | Can be significantly heavier |
| Dress (cotton/silk) | 150-400 | 5.3-14.1 | Dependent on fabric and style |
| Underwear (cotton) | 50-100 | 1.8-3.5 | Lightweight and varies by size |
| Socks (cotton/wool) | 20-50 | 0.7-1.8 | Weight depends on material and thickness |
The Implications of Clothing Weight
Understanding clothing weight is important for various practical applications:
-
Travel Packing: Knowing the weight of your clothing allows for efficient packing and prevents exceeding airline baggage limits.
-
Laundry Management: Heavier loads of laundry require longer wash and dry cycles, impacting both energy consumption and wear on your washing machine.
-
Athletic Performance: In sports and activities where minimizing weight is crucial, the weight of clothing can affect performance and endurance.
-
Comfort and Ergonomics: Heavy clothing can be uncomfortable, especially during hot weather or strenuous activities.
-
Environmental Considerations: The weight of clothing is indirectly related to material usage and the environmental impact of textile production. Lighter clothing often requires less material and energy to produce.
Frequently Asked Questions (FAQ)
Q: How do I weigh my clothes accurately?
A: Use a kitchen or postal scale. Weigh the garment individually for the most precise measurement.
Q: How much does a typical winter coat weigh?
A: A typical winter coat can weigh anywhere from 1000 grams (approximately 2.2 pounds) to over 2000 grams (approximately 4.4 pounds), depending on the material and style.
Q: Does the weight of clothes affect how quickly they dry?
A: Yes, heavier clothes generally take longer to dry than lighter clothes because they retain more moisture.
Q: How can I reduce the weight of my luggage when traveling?
A: Choose lightweight fabrics, pack efficiently, and consider wearing your heaviest items on the plane.
Q: Are there any online tools to calculate clothing weight?
A: Currently, there aren't widely available, reliable online tools specifically designed to calculate clothing weight. The most accurate method remains using a scale.
Q: How does clothing weight impact athletic performance?
A: In sports like running or cycling, even small weight differences in clothing can cumulatively affect performance over distance.
